What is the missing constant term in the perfect square that starts with x^2-8xx 2 −8xx, squared, minus, 8, x ?

Your notation is very confusing.

If you mean to complete the square for x2 - 8x, the answer is 16, i.e. (x - 4)2 = x2 - 8x + 16.

If that is not what you mean, you will need to clarify your notation and re-submit your question.
